Output 345836e1edb76af3a28fcb871405303a0620369ad6606cb38fac250f6b4384a0:0

value
5508600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8067e8f2b77c07d60dce980124fc224da7d78e25 OP_EQUAL
address
3DPxttU8gPKtbUEJuW1rwUWHASj4Hzx14D
transaction
345836e1edb76af3a28fcb871405303a0620369ad6606cb38fac250f6b4384a0
spent
true